With over 15 years of experience in the financial services industry, I have been actively engaged in fostering strong client relationships and helping clients achieve their personal financial goals.
I hold an MBA (MMS) degree in Management from University of Mumbai.
My commitment to continuous education has earned me the Certified Financial Planner (CFP®) designation conferred by the Financial Planning Standards Council, Personal Financial Planner (PFP®) designation conferred by the Canadian Securities Institute and the Registered Retirement Consultant (RRC®) designation conferred by the Canadian Institute of Financial Planning.

Monthly Perspectives | Standing in a Bucket | June 2025
The One Big Beautiful Bill Act is a big piece of legislation, and it includes many proposed tax measures in the U.S. that impact non-citizens and non-residents. This includes a new Section 899, increasing federal income tax and withholding tax rates on U.S.-sourced income earned by Canadian corporations and individuals. Let’s expect the best but plan for the worst. At the end of the day, the best way to manage risk is to ensure you have the right plan in place and stay diversified.

A tale of two commodities: Why gold could rally while oil’s outlook remains weak
Year to date, the prices of gold and oil have been moving in very different directions. As the precious metal hits new highs, crude has been languishing as it faces concerns about oversupply and soft demand. Andriy Yastreb, Vice President, Director and Portfolio Manager with TD Asset Management, gives his outlook for commodity-related equities as these trends play out.
